- Write down your questions before the meeting and prioritize the questions are most important to you.
- Let your child's teacher know ahead of time if there is anything specific you hope to talk about- that way they can tailor the conference to best address your questions or concerns.
- Don't be shy! If your child's teacher is using educational jargon or discussing test results and you aren't clear on the meaning- ask for clarification.
- Ask your child what they think should be discussed. Be prepared to update your kiddo after that conference.
- A parent-teacher conference is often the start of a conversation, not the end. If you feel like 15 minutes is not sufficient time or there are more concerns to discuss, set up a follow up meeting with your child's teacher.

Best defense in cold and flu season
To prevent the spread of viruses such as the flu, common cold and coronavirus the Michigan Department of Education and the Michigan Department of Health and Human Services recommend:
- Remain at home if you are sick and avoid close contact with people who are sick.
- Avoid touching your eyes, nose, and mouth with unwashed hands.
- Wash your hands often with soap and water for at least 20 seconds.
- Use an alcohol-based hand sanitizer that contains at least 60% alcohol if soap and water are unavailable.
- Cover cough with a tissue or sleeve. Provide adequate supplies within easy reach, including tissues and no-touch trash cans.
- Routinely clean frequently touched surfaces.
